A casting that moves from Nourishment into After Completion means the situation you asked about is not static — it begins as one pattern and resolves into another. The first hexagram describes where you stand; the second describes where events are carrying you.
Highlighted in red: lines 3, 5 and 6 are moving — counted from the bottom. A moving line is where the change is actually happening: it flips from yang to yin or back, and that flip is what turns Nourishment into After Completion.

Structurally, Nourishment is Thunder below Mountain — the inner state meeting the outer condition. That pairing is the lens for everything above.
